In the days leading up to AEW Double or Nothing that is set to take place this Sunday, all eyes are on one man who is set to make a huge return to in-ring action- Sting. The WCW legend will return to live-action inside a ring in front of fans for the first time in over 5 years, and expectations are high.

However, the significant part of his stint so far in AEW is the relationship with former TNT Champion Darby Allin, of whom he acts as a mentor. Speaking to Paste, ’The Icon’ revealed how the entire angle with Darby Allin was presented to him and how it’s currently going for the two.

“Just to be straight-up, it was something that was put in front of me. It was Tony Khan. I’m grateful for that,” Sting said. “To be honest with you, I don’t know who’s mentoring who. [Laughs] Of course I do have some things I can bring after 35 years of being in the wrestling industry.

“But one thing that I found after being out of it for five, six years, as far as actually physically being in the ring and wrestling, is that it evolves, it changes. And man, it changed a ton. And Darby, he’s kind of getting me up to speed, to be honest with you,” Sting admitted. “He really is. He’s a go-getter kind of a guy, for sure—very talented in the ring, and extremely talented outside the ring.”

Sting sees his younger self in Darby Allin

‘The Franchise’ compared Allin to his younger self and noted how they are both alike in outlook. 

“It’s not that you’ve arrived or figured everything out, but you really have your finger on the pulse of the wrestling industry and the fans, and what they think,” Sting explained, “and how to manipulate, and how to just be victorious in your storytelling, let’s say. And Darby, he’s that guy. He’s that guy right now.

Sting did compete alongside Darby Allin in a cinematic match earlier this year but will have to do it for real inside the ring at Double or Nothing. The duo will face Scorpio Sky and Ethan Page and this return could pose several challenges for ‘The Icon’, given that he can’t take solid bumps like he used to.
